About J O'donnell

J O'donnell is a scholar working on Rheumatology, Immunology, Pulmonary and Respiratory Medicine, Radiology, Nuclear Medicine and Imaging and Nephrology, having authored 62 papers that have together received 1.8k indexed citations. Recurring topics across this work include Rheumatoid Arthritis Research and Therapies (14 papers), Monoclonal and Polyclonal Antibodies Research (10 papers), Vasculitis and related conditions (9 papers), Chronic Lymphocytic Leukemia Research (8 papers), Inflammatory Myopathies and Dermatomyositis (8 papers), Immunotherapy and Immune Responses (7 papers), Gout, Hyperuricemia, Uric Acid (7 papers) and Sarcoidosis and Beryllium Toxicity Research (7 papers). The work is most often cited by research in Nephrology (373 citations), Rheumatology (731 citations), Genetics (255 citations), Hematology (255 citations) and Immunology (380 citations).
